Friends Annual Support Campaign

by Sara Vogt - December 16, 2016

Each year Friends of Soldiers and Sailors Memorial Hospital ensure that quality healthcare services are accessible in Tioga County and surrounding communities, both now and in the future.

As part of UPMC Susquehanna, our mission is to extend God’s healing love by improving the health of those we serve. We are dedicated to providing continuous innovation and the highest quality care to restore health and save lives.

As a non-profit health system, we rely on contributions from our community to continue our mission.

Friends of Soldiers and Sailors Memorial Hospital share a special commitment to our health system through an annual, tax-deductible membership of $100 or more. Membership funds are used to purchase vital equipment and expand community health programs.

The information above is included in the brochure encouraging us to join and become a friend of Soldiers and Sailors Memorial Hospital and continue the work that so many of us who live here have started.

This year the funds raised will help to purchase equipment for the rehabilitation services which will benefit the patients they serve. The different pieces that they are requesting are the Biofeedback machine, Physio Touch, Vitalstim Kit and Scifit ISO 7000 Upright Bike.

We spoke with the Director of Rehabilitation Services, Aaron Stephens who shared the team’s desire for more devices called Physio Touch. Presently they have one unit being utilized by the their new practice in Mansfield. “This device has actually been proven to reduce the lymphedema (or swelling) three times faster than just the manual therapy alone.” says Mr. Stephens. “It’s helps reduce costs and frequency of visits for patients…with lymphatic buildup.” When asked what the support from the community meant to him and his team he responded, ” … our job is a service job, we got into it for the purpose of wanting to help other people and to have the community support us in doing that, it’s spectacular.”

We also had the opportunity to find out about the Biofeedback machine from Physical Therapist, Brooke Patt, another piece of equipment on their list. Brooke is in the process of taking advanced women’s health training courses and will be achieving certification through the American Board of Physical Therapy Specialties in approximately one year. Additionally, these specialists will be able to provide intervention for male patients who have undergone prostate CA treatment and are experiencing incontinence issues. How will biofeedback help her as a therapist? Brooke stated that the machine will help to train pelvic floors giving her and the patient the ability to work together for solutions to their particular situations for treatment. She reinforces that many of the problems in the pelvic floor are treatable.
